News Corp. and Japan's Softbank Corp. announced plans Tuesday to bring MySpace, the popular Internet social networking site, to Asia. The 50-50 joint venture MySpace KK will be run mostly separately from News Corp., the site's New York-based parent company, the two companies said.

The founders of the popular social networking site MySpace.com are among the winners of this year's Webby online achievement awards. Tom Anderson and Chris DeWolfe will receive an award next month for breakout of the year.
